Special Economic Zone (SEZ) at West Jalefa, Tripura

Published on October 07, 2019
Current context: The government has approved setting up of a Special Economic Zone (SEZ) at West Jalefa in Sabroom subdivision of South Tripura on 4th October 2019.
Special Economic Zone (SEZ) at West Jalefa, Tripura 
  • The decision was taken during the 92nd meeting of the Board of Approval (BoA) under the Ministry of commerce.
  • The Tripura government submitted a proposal in June this year, to the Ministry of Industries and Commerce for the setting of an agro-based SEZ at Jalefa.
  • An estimated investment of around Rs. 1550 crore will be made in setting up first-ever SEZ.
  • A special economic zone (SEZ) is a geographical region that has more liberal economic laws that a country's domestic economic laws and are approved for Agro and Food Processing sectors in India.
  • Under the plan, rubber thread, apparel making, bamboo, rubber-based industrial units, and food process units are proposed to be set up.
